What is Search Engine Optimization (SEO)?
Search engine optimization (SEO) is a long-standing digital marketing discipline focused on improving a website's visibility in unpaid, or "organic," search results. For B2B SaaS teams, this means optimizing your website and content to rank highly for keywords relevant to your product or service on platforms like Google. The goal of B2B SaaS SEO is to drive qualified traffic to your website by appearing prominently in the search engine results pages (SERPs).
Traditional SEO involves a multifaceted approach, including technical SEO (site speed, mobile-friendliness, crawlability), on-page SEO (keyword optimization, content quality, meta descriptions), and off-page SEO (backlink building, brand mentions). The better your search engine optimization, the more likely potential customers are to discover your solutions when they actively search for them. This foundational work remains incredibly important, as a well-optimized website serves as the primary source of truth for both human users and, increasingly, AI models, impacting overall AI visibility.
For B2B SaaS, robust SEO ensures that your product pages, solution guides, and thought leadership content are discoverable by decision-makers and influencers. It builds authority and trust, which are critical components for any online presence. Without strong SEO, your valuable content might remain hidden, regardless of its quality, making it harder to attract and convert your target audience.
What is Answer Engine Optimization (AEO)?
Answer engine optimization (AEO), also known as generative engine optimization or AI search optimization, is the practice of optimizing your brand's content to be featured in AI-generated answers. This goes beyond simply ranking in search results, aiming for your brand, products, or services to be directly cited, mentioned, or recommended when users pose questions to AI models like ChatGPT, Gemini, Perplexity, and Claude. The objective is to achieve high AI visibility and a strong AI share of voice within these conversational interfaces, a key component of any effective AI marketing strategy.
AEO responds to a fundamental shift in how people access information. Instead of sifting through ten blue links, users are now asking AI assistants direct questions and receiving synthesized answers. For B2B SaaS, this means your brand could be introduced to a prospect much earlier in their buying journey, sometimes before they even visit a traditional search engine. Optimizing for AEO involves structuring content for clarity, factuality, and direct answers, making it easy for AI models to extract and present your information accurately, thus improving AI search optimization.
Achieving strong AEO means focusing on how AI models process, understand, and summarize information. This includes ensuring factual accuracy, using clear and concise language, and providing definitive answers to common questions within your niche. Ultimately, the goal is to drive AI citations, where AI engines explicitly reference your brand or website as a source of information, significantly boosting your brand visibility in ChatGPT and other AI platforms.
AEO vs. SEO: A Strategic Comparison
While both SEO and AEO aim to improve discoverability, their methodologies, objectives, and measurement strategies differ significantly. Understanding these distinctions is crucial for developing a comprehensive AI marketing strategy that encompasses both answer engine optimization and search engine optimization.
Key Differences in Focus and Methodology
- SEO Focus: Primarily concerned with improving website rankings in traditional search engine results pages (SERPs). The methodology involves keyword research, technical optimization, content creation, and link building to satisfy search engine algorithms, supporting overall search engine optimization efforts.
- AEO Focus: Centered on ensuring your brand, products, or services are cited, mentioned, or recommended in AI-generated answers. This requires optimizing content for AI consumption, focusing on clarity, conciseness, and direct answers to common user queries, driving AI citations and a strong AI share of voice. It also involves understanding how AI models attribute information and generate summaries for effective generative engine optimization and AI search optimization.
Comparison Matrix: AEO vs. SEO
| Feature | Search Engine Optimization (SEO) | Answer Engine Optimization (AEO) |
|---|---|---|
| Primary Goal | Rank high in SERPs, drive organic website traffic | Be cited/mentioned/recommended in AI answers, increase AI share of voice |
| Target Platform | Google, Bing, traditional search engines | ChatGPT, Gemini, Perplexity, Claude, AI-powered search experiences |
| Key Metrics | Organic rankings, website traffic, conversions, keyword positions | AI share of voice, AI citations, mention frequency, prompt coverage |
| Content Strategy | Comprehensive articles, blog posts, landing pages, keyword-rich content | Concise, factual answers, structured data, FAQs, clear definitions |
| Optimization Tactics | Technical SEO, on-page SEO, off-page SEO, link building | Content clarity, factual accuracy, LLM-friendly structuring (e.g., llms.txt), prompt engineering understanding |
| Measurement | Google Analytics, Search Console, SEO tools | AEO trackers, AI visibility platforms (e.g., AEOVisor), manual prompt testing |
| Time to Impact | Medium to long-term (months to years) | Potentially faster for direct answers, but consistent visibility is long-term |
While SEO is about being found when someone searches, AEO is about being recommended when someone asks. Both require high-quality content, but AEO demands an additional layer of optimization for AI comprehension and synthesis to achieve optimal AI visibility.

Measuring Success in the AI-First Era
Measuring the effectiveness of your AEO efforts requires a new set of metrics and tools. Traditional SEO metrics, while still relevant, don't fully capture your brand's performance in AI-generated answers. Key AEO Metrics for B2B SaaS Teams
| Metric | What it measures | Why it matters |
|---|---|---|
| AI Share of Voice | The percentage of AI-generated answers in your category that mention or recommend your brand compared to competitors. | Directly reflects your brand's prominence and influence in AI conversations. A higher share means more AI-driven recommendations. |
| AI Citations | The frequency and quality of direct references or links to your website/brand within AI answers. | Indicates that AI engines trust your content as a primary source, driving direct traffic and building authority. |
| Mention Frequency | How often your brand is mentioned, even without a direct citation, for relevant queries. | Shows AI models are aware of your brand and considering it in their summaries, influencing brand recall. |
| Competitor Presence | Tracking which competitors are mentioned or cited by AI for your target keywords. | Helps identify gaps in your AEO strategy and understand competitor strengths in the AI landscape. |
| Prompt Coverage | The range of prompts and questions for which your brand appears in AI answers. | Ensures your AEO efforts are broad enough to cover the diverse ways users might ask about your solutions. |
| Fix Priority Score | A score indicating the impact of specific technical or content fixes on your AI visibility. | Prioritizes actionable steps, ensuring your team focuses on changes that yield the greatest AEO improvements. |
